    How to tell if bake and broil elements are bad or is it control panel?

    Model Number: FEF336ECE
    Brand: Frigidaire
    Age: 1-5 years

    Yesterday afternoon oven works fine. Last night it would not heat up. I also checked broil and that would not work either and it worked fine last time I used it in the last month. How do I tell if the elements are bad or if the control panel went bad or if it is something else. Stove top works fine. Any help would be appreciated. Not exactly sure of age of unit, was here when we bought place 3 years ago.

    Eileen,

    If the top burners are working okay, then that means that the stove is getting adequate power. It is not very likely that the bake element and broil elements would burn out at the same time, so it is most likely the control board that is bad. With the stove unplugged, you can remove the back panel of the range. I would inspect and look for any burn spots on the control board, burned or broken wires, and if you have access to an multimeter or ohm meter you can test the bake and broil elements for continuity. This is how you can test the elements to see if they are good or bad. Let us know how the repair goes for you.

    Before replacing the control board, make sure the overlay (sticker on the front that labels the buttons) will peal off in one piece. If it doesn't, then you will need to order the overlay too.

    These are the parts for your range:

    Oven Control Board - 316455400


    Touchpad Overlay (Black) - 316220701
